Does overclocking need more cooling?

Does overclocking need more cooling?

Increasing a component’s clock rate causes it to perform more operations per second, but it also produces additional heat. Overclocking can help squeeze more performance out of your components, but they’ll often need additional cooling and care.

Do I need liquid cooling for overclocking?

No, you don. t need watercooling for overclock. However depending on the cpu and depending on the clocks you want to reach, you might want to consider watercooling in order for safer temps. But you can easily overclock without watercooling.

Is air cooling enough for overclocking?

Air cooling is fine for moderate overclocks, but for those who want to push their chip to the brink of death just to get every last drop of performance, they’d go liquid cooling. If you’re overclocking, a fairly large heatsink is preferable. Just don’t push too hard on the throttles.

Should I overclock with stock cooling?

Yes you can OC with stock cooler, but the temps will be very hot and it will throttle. The only job of af heatsink is to cool down your CPU which the stock heatsink simply can’t do. I’d advise against it. Also, the freezing is most likely due to GPU issues not CPU.

Can you Overcool CPU?

There is no way to overcool a cpu – that’s just nonsense. Whether you should add the side fans should be dictated by your temperatures.

Does i9 need water cooling?

You’ll be fine with a top air cooler unless you want to be squeeze everything out of your CPU. I run my 9900K @ 5GHz with 1.3V since last October without any issues on my NH-D15. Max temps are 99C with Prime95 29.4 without AVX. A little hot, but at gaming it never goes above 75C.

Is Water cooling worth it 2021?

Liquid cooling is the best way to cool a CPU because water transfers heat much more efficiently than air. Liquid cooling also makes your PC run quieter because you won’t have fans constantly running at a high RPM. However, liquid cooling a PC can also be dangerous if water leaks onto hardware.

Can you overclock Ryzen 3600 with stock cooler?

The included cooler — the Wraith Stealth — won’t handle an overclocked 3600. It’s only designed to handle it at stock, and even then, it can get pretty toasty under heavy/max load.

Is Ryzen stock cooler good for overclocking?

The Wraith Stealth is a decent cooler, although as it’s designed for 65W CPUs it will ultimately going to hold back your overclocking exploits. You should still be able to hit some impressive clocks, but you’re going to have to keep a close eye on the temperatures as you’re overclocking.

Why does my CPU overheat when overclocking?

As previously mentioned, in order to achieve higher overclocks you also need to increase the voltage provided to the CPU. Heat is one byproduct of this which is a problem, but the voltage itself could also be a problem. Too high voltage on your CPU can actually fry the chip, killing it.

What is overclocking and how does it work?

If you are unfamiliar, overclocking is the process of setting your CPU multiplier higher so that your processor speeds up, and speeds up everything else on your computer, too.

Is it better to overclock a CPU manually or automatically?

Usually the automated overclocks are a bit conservative, which guarantees a higher level of stability, at the cost of not fully utilizing the potential of your chip. If you’re a tinkerer like me who wants to get every drop of performance out of your system, a manual overclock is much more effective.
